Abstract
1,263,760. Treating polyolefin articles. AVISUN CORP. 10 Oct., 1969 [11 Oct., 1968], No. 49793/69. Heading C3P. [Also in Divisions C6-C7] Shaped polyolefin articles are treated, prior to the deposition of metallic coatings, with a ketone which is dispersible, emulsifiable or at least slightly soluble in water, by contacting to such an extent that the ketone penetrates the surface of the polyolefin article and relieves strains therein. The ketone may be acetone or methyl ethyl ketone applied in the liquid or vapour state. The article may subsequently be treated with a solution of chromium trioxide or an alkali metal chromate in a strong mineral acid, and subjected to vacuum metallizing or chemical- and electro-plating. Specified polymers are polymers and copolymers of ethylene, propylene, butene-1, 3-methylbutene-1 and 4- methylpentene-1, optionally with minor proportions of functional monomers such as acrylonitrile, methylmethacrylate, ethyl acrylate and vinyl acetate. Examples describe the treatment of articles made from (1 and 2) polypropylene, (3) ethylene/propylene copolymer and (4) a composition of polypropylene, t-octylphenol/ ethylene oxide condensate, dilauryl thiodipropionate and titanium dioxide.
